Twinaxial Cable

Abbreviated as twinax, a twinaxial cable is a cable with three conductors. Two conductors are insulated wires in the center of the cable. The other conductor surrounds the first two conductors and they are separated by a layer of insulation. Typically, twinax is used to connect AS/400 computers with its devices.
